

零知识证明(Zero-Knowledge Proof,ZKP)是密码学领域的重要概念,也是加密货币行业的核心技术之一。它允许证明者在不泄露任何秘密信息的前提下,向验证者证明自己拥有某项信息。例如,假如David拥有世界顶级肉酱意大利面食谱,却不希望向John公开食谱细节,但又需要证明确实持有该食谱,零知识证明就是理想的解决方案。这项技术在加密货币及区块链领域,兼顾隐私保护与信息验证,已成为现代数字社会不可或缺的创新手段。
零知识证明依托于证明者和验证者之间的一系列密码学协议,整个流程分为多个阶段。
首先,证明者(David)和验证者(John)需就加密参数及算法达成共识,以统一标准进行证明和验证。随后,证明者在不泄露秘密信息(如食谱细节)的情况下,生成用于证明其持有信息的密码学承诺。这一承诺在密码学层面保证了秘密信息的存在,但信息本身依然处于隐藏状态。
接下来,验证者会向证明者发出随机挑战。该挑战无法被提前预知,其设计目的是防止证明者事先准备。证明者根据已作出的承诺,针对挑战生成相应回应。最后,验证者检查回应,通过验证挑战与承诺在数学上的一致性,判断证明是否成立。
上述流程可多次重复,重复次数越多,证明的可信度呈指数级增长。ZKP本质上由承诺、挑战、回应三大阶段组成,通过相互作用实现信息不泄露的证明过程。
零知识证明之所以在加密货币及区块链行业备受重视,是因其在隐私保护与可扩展性方面兼具优势。随着数字化进程加速,个人信息保护已成为社会关注焦点;与此同时,加密货币、区块链及金融系统等场景也对透明度提出了刚性需求。
尤其是在大型企业大量收集数据的环境下,既要保护个人隐私,又需验证必要信息的有效性,相关机制变得不可或缺。ZKP能够在完全不泄露秘密信息的前提下,证明信息的真实性,兼顾隐私性与透明度这两个看似对立的需求。
此外,ZKP显著提升数据处理效率。由于能将海量交易或复杂计算压缩为简洁证明,整体系统的可扩展性因此大幅提升。这些特性使ZKP在加密货币交易、金融服务、医疗信息管理、投票系统、供应链管理等领域均具备广阔应用前景。
零知识证明有多种技术实现,各具特色与优势。主要类型包括ZK-SNARKs和ZK-STARKs。
ZK-SNARKs(Zero-Knowledge Succinct Non-Interactive Argument of Knowledge)是一种无需证明者与验证者交互即可生成极为简洁证明的方案。该技术基于椭圆曲线密码学,具备证明体积小、验证速度快等优点。但在初始化阶段需进行可信设置(Trusted Setup),设置不当可能会影响系统安全。
ZK-STARKs(Zero-Knowledge Scalable Transparent Argument of Knowledge)则采用哈希函数而非椭圆曲线密码学,提供与SNARKs类似的功能。其最大优势是无需可信设置,还具备抗量子计算机能力,适应未来技术演进。然而,证明体积相较SNARKs更大。
两种方案各适用于不同场景与需求,具体选择需结合系统特点。
零知识证明因其独特优势,正在加密货币及相关行业加速落地。由于兼顾隐私保护与可扩展性,尤其在处理高敏感数据的加密货币领域备受关注。
在加密货币交易场景中,ZKP用于在不公开交易细节的前提下证明资金合法性与交易合规性。此举不仅保护商业敏感信息,也满足合规监管要求。此外,若需证明持有特定数量以上资产但不愿公开个人资产状况,ZKP亦可发挥作用。
投票系统中,ZKP可在保障投票者匿名的同时验证投票有效性,实现投票透明和隐私保护双重目标。
区块链技术领域,ZKP以ZK Rollups形态出现,为以太坊等网络解决可扩展性瓶颈。ZK Rollups通过链下处理交易并利用ZKP进行合法性证明,大幅降低主链负载,实现更高处理速度和更低手续费。
ZK Rollups是专为以太坊及其他区块链平台打造的Layer 2扩展技术。这项创新针对区块链处理能力有限、交易手续费高昂等根本性难题,提供了有效解决方案。
ZK Rollups的理念是在链下(即主区块链之外)批量处理海量交易,汇总后生成证明,再将证明记录到主链。具体而言,借助zk-SNARK等零知识证明技术,生成能展现大量交易合法性的紧凑型证明。
此方法显著减少主链需处理和存储的数据量,有效缓解网络拥堵。同时,交易处理能力大幅提升,手续费成本降低。更关键的是,即使交易在链下完成,仍可获得与主链相同的安全保障,因为所有交易合法性均经密码学验证。
ZK Rollups的运作机制由多个阶段组成,流程严密。
第一阶段为交易汇总。用户发起的大量交易会在链下收集整理,整体归为一个批次,并生成统一的数据结构。此举大幅减少主链需单独处理的交易数量,缓解网络压力。
第二阶段是生成zk-SNARK,用于证明批量交易的合法性。该证明以密码学方式保障批次中所有交易均有效且正确执行,并且证明极为紧凑,不含单笔交易细节,从而保护隐私并最小化数据体积。
第三阶段是在主链上进行验证。生成的证明上传至主链并进行高效验证,远低于逐笔验证的计算成本。验证通过后,批次中所有交易导致的状态变更会同步更新区块链账本。
通过上述流程,ZK Rollups实现了可扩展性、安全性与隐私性的有机统一。
随着零知识证明技术不断进步,越来越多ZK Rollup项目进入开发和部署阶段。以下介绍几个在加密货币领域尤为值得关注的项目。
zkSync是以解决以太坊扩展瓶颈为目标的先驱项目。平台采用zk-rollup技术,大幅提升交易速度并显著降低Gas费用,同时为开发者提供友好环境,与以太坊现有工具高度兼容。
Linea是ConsenSys基于zkEVM技术开发的扩展解决方案。项目特点在于完全兼容以太坊虚拟机(EVM),并叠加零知识证明优势,使现有以太坊应用可无障碍移植。
Starknet利用zk-rollup技术提升以太坊交易处理能力,采用独创编程语言Cairo,实现高效、安全的智能合约开发。
Polygon zkEVM是Polygon生态系统旗下的高性能Layer 2解决方案,针对以太坊Gas费和交易速度瓶颈,为开发者构建易用环境。
Scroll是以zk-rollup技术为核心的以太坊Layer 2项目,设计重点是EVM兼容性,实现安全性、性能与可扩展性的平衡。
这些项目各具技术特色与优势,均为区块链可扩展性难题贡献力量,推动加密货币行业持续发展。
零知识证明(ZKP)作为现代密码学与区块链技术的核心创新,正日益成为加密货币领域的重要基础。凭借隐私保护、安全性与可扩展性,ZKP技术为加密货币交易和区块链应用带来革命性突破。随着ZK Rollups等实际应用日益成熟,零知识证明技术将持续推动加密货币生态系统演进,为构建更高效、更隐私、更安全的去中心化未来奠定坚实基础。
ZKP虚拟货币是应用零知识证明技术的加密货币。其主要优势包括:增强隐私保护,交易细节无需公开;提升安全性,无需依赖第三方验证;提高交易效率,支持大规模扩展处理;降低交易成本,减轻网络压力。ZKP技术让区块链既保持透明,又有效保障用户隐私。
代表性项目包括Zcash(隐私交易)、Polygon zkEVM、StarkNet、zkSync等zk-Rollup方案。这些项目利用零知识证明提升隐私性和扩展性,是区块链基础设施创新的重要典范。
ZKP虚拟货币借助零知识证明技术,使用户无需披露身份、资产或交易历史即可完成交易验证,全面保护隐私。交易信息在区块链上加密隐藏,实现匿名且安全的交易。
ZKP虚拟货币具备高度安全性,能强化隐私保护、防范欺诈。但技术实现缺陷、算法漏洞及市场波动可能带来风险。采用规范标准和多重审计可提升整体安全水平。
ZKP技术将在隐私保护与数据安全方面发挥关键作用。未来将助力提升可扩展性,广泛应用于各类区块链解决方案,推动行业向更安全高效方向发展。











